What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Associate Human Resources professional, and why are they important?

To excel as an Associate Human Resources professional, you need a solid understanding of HR principles, employment law, and basic recruitment processes,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in human resources or a related field. Familiarity with HR information systems (HRIS), applicant tracking systems (ATS), and Microsoft Office Suite is often required, and certifications like SHRM-CP can be advantageous. Strong interpersonal skills, attention to detail, and discretion with sensitive information help build trust and foster a positive work environment. These competencies are critical for ensuring compliance, maintaining accurate records, and supporting effective talent management within the organization.

What are some common challenges faced by Associate Human Resources professionals in their day-to-day work?

Associate Human Resources professionals often encounter challenges such as balancing multiple tasks like recruitment coordination, onboarding, and employee inquiries, all while maintaining confidentiality and accuracy. They may also face situations where they must mediate minor workplace conflicts or support new HR initiatives under tight deadlines. Adapting to new HR technologies and ensuring compliance with company policies and labor regulations are other frequent aspects of the role. Effective communication, time management, and a proactive approach can help overcome these common challenges.

What are Associate Human Resources?

Associate Human Resources, often called HR Associates, are entry- to mid-level professionals who support various human resources functions within an organization. Their responsibilities may include assisting with recruitment, onboarding, employee records management, benefits administration, and responding to employee inquiries. They act as a bridge between employees and management, ensuring HR policies and procedures are followed. This position typically requires strong organizational and communication skills and provides a foundation for more advanced HR roles.

Job description

Elite Corporate Solutions is seeking a Human Resources Generalist to support our growing staffing operations and client accounts. This role is responsible for managing key HR functions throughout the employee lifecycle, including onboarding, employee relations, benefits administration, workers' compensation, payroll coordination, recruiting support, and HR compliance.
The ideal candidate is highly organized, detail-oriented, and thrives in a fast-paced staffing environment. This is a hands-on operational role that requires strong follow-up, excellent communication, and the ability to manage multiple priorities while delivering exceptional service to both employees and clients.
What You'll Do
  • Coordinate employee onboarding from offer acceptance through first day of employment.
  • Prepare offer letters and communicate compensation packages and employment details.
  • Create and maintain employee records within ADP and other HR systems.
  • Coordinate background checks, drug screenings, client-specific onboarding requirements, and employment documentation.
  • Serve as a primary HR contact for employees, clients, recruiters, and hiring managers.
  • Support employee relations by responding to HR-related questions and assisting with employment matters.
  • Administer employee benefits, enrollments, eligibility changes, and insurance communications.
  • Coordinate workers' compensation claims and maintain communication with employees, insurance carriers, healthcare providers, and clients.
  • Review payroll-related information, timekeeping records, PTO, and employment changes for accuracy.
  • Partner with payroll and accounting to ensure employee information is processed accurately and on time.
  • Support recruiting activities and ensure a smooth transition from candidate selection through onboarding.
  • Monitor compliance with company policies, client requirements, and employment documentation.
  • Maintain accurate, organized, and confidential HR records.
  • Collaborate with recruiting, payroll, accounting, leadership, and client contacts to support day-to-day staffing operations.
What We're Looking For
  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field preferred.
  • Minimum 3 years of Human Resources Generalist, HR Operations, or Staffing industry experience.
  • Experience with employee onboarding, employee relations, payroll coordination, benefits administration, workers' compensation, and recruiting.
  • Experience using ADP or a comparable HRIS/payroll system.
  • Knowledge of federal and state employment regulations.
  • Strong organizational skills with exceptional attention to detail.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, including Outlook, Excel, Word, and Teams.
  • Bilingual English/Spanish
  • Previous staffing agency or multi-client HR experience strongly preferred.
